The Washington Street construction project was the target of serious debate for a number of years. Citizens realized that there was a desperate need for improvement along this busy stretch of road, however were also concerned about the widened road creating other problems, including the loss of historic trees along the boulevard. Compromises were eventually made and the construction was completed in October 2007.
In northern Bismarck, Washington Street is the main road to Horizon Middle School and also passes by Northbrook Mall. The YMCA and Tom O'Leary Golf Course are located near the intersection of Divide Avenue.
Washington Street widens to four lanes in southern Bismarck, south of Rosser Avenue, through the western edge of downtown. Once rated the most dangerous intersection in Bismarck, the intersection of Bismarck Expressway sees heavy traffic, and is also home to several nearby restaurants & retailers.
Washing Street is also an important part of the address system in Bismarck, with all streets east of Washington designated as "East" and vice-versa. The street numbering system is also based on Washington Street's location.
